Programme Description

The PravoJustice4EU Programme, implemented by Expertise France (EF) with funding from the European Union, accompanies Ukrainian authorities in the process of comprehensive justice sector reform. EU4Pravo-Justice is envisaged to build on the results achieved by the predecessor projects (Pravo - Justice I; II; III) who, since 2017, have supported an ambitious sectoral reform agenda. PravoJustice4EU is organized alongside two specific objectives: Support the EU accession process by aligning the Ukrainian justice system to EU standards (Pillar 1), and Support a process of accountability for core international crimes aligned on European and international standards and foster a holistic transitional justice approach (Pillar 2). 

PravoJustice4EU will continue to support Ukraine's efforts to ensure accountability for core international crimes in line with European and international standards. The programme will contribute to strengthening the legal and institutional framework, enhancing the capacities of national justice and law enforcement institutions, and reinforcing cooperation with European and international accountability mechanisms, while supporting Ukraine's leading role in investigating and prosecuting these crimes.

In parallel, the programme will promote a comprehensive and victim-centred approach to accountability by supporting the development of a broader transitional justice framework. Through strengthened institutional capacities, improved coordination, and the promotion of international best practices, PravoJustice4EU will contribute to ensuring that accountability efforts address both judicial and non-judicial dimensions, fostering justice, trust, and the long-term resilience of Ukraine's rule of law institutions.

Expertise France is the public agency for designing and implementing international technical cooperation projects. The agency operates around four key priorities :

  • democratic, economic, and financial governance ;
  • peace, stability, and security ;
  • climate, agriculture, and sustainable development ;
  • health and human development ;

In these areas, Expertise France conducts capacity-building initiatives and manages project implementation, leveraging technical expertise and acting as a project coordinator. This involves combining public sector expertise with private sector skills to drive impactful results.
